Why is it essential to allow children to serve themselves during meals?

Explanation:
Allowing children to serve themselves during meals promotes a better understanding of portion sizes because it empowers them to make choices about how much food they would like to eat. When children have the opportunity to decide their own portions, they can learn to listen to their hunger cues and recognize when they are full, fostering a more intuitive relationship with food. This practice can help them develop self-regulation skills concerning eating, which is important for their overall health and nutrition as they grow. Additionally, being involved in the process of serving themselves can increase their engagement with the meal, making them more likely to try new foods and enjoy a wider variety of foods in a balanced diet.
